Kevin, with a sour face, took out goggles and earmuffs from his bag and threw them to Li Ang and Liu Yue, then demonstrated to them how to put them on.
The reason for wearing goggles is that the Glock 19, as a semi-automatic pistol, ejects its spent cartridges very forcefully, resulting in very high temperatures and speeds, making them easy to hit the face.
At the same time, there is a risk that gunpowder gas, metal fragments, sand and dust will be blown towards the shooter by the airflow during firing.
Earmuffs, on the other hand, can protect everyone's hearing in a sealed cellar.
It should be noted that the sound of a handgun gun is usually between 140 and 170 decibels, far exceeding the human safety threshold of 85 decibels.
Practicing shooting without protection for a long time can easily cause permanent hearing loss.
Therefore, proper shooting ranges will require the wearing of protective gear.
